Living in Warner Robins, GA

Transportation in Warner Robins is facilitated by a network of major roads and highways, including Highway 247 and Watson Boulevard, which provide convenient access for commuting and travel. Public transportation services are available, offering routes that connect key areas of the city. The community is also bike-friendly, with certain areas offering dedicated bike lanes. While ride-sharing services are operational in the area, specific schedules and availability may vary.

The community is served by a comprehensive educational system, including a number of public and private schools that cater to various educational needs. Healthcare services are readily available, with several clinics and a major hospital providing a range of medical care from primary to specialized treatments. The public library system supports lifelong learning with a variety of programs and resources. Retail and dining options are abundant, offering both national chains and local establishments that reflect the culinary diversity and culture of Warner Robins.

Warner Robins is celebrated for its strong sense of community and family-friendly atmosphere. The city prides itself on hosting events like the annual Independence Day Celebration, which showcases the patriotic spirit and camaraderie among residents. The community's character is further defined by its well-maintained parks and recreational areas that serve as popular gathering spots for families and outdoor enthusiasts.

Warner Robins offers a diverse array of housing options, with single-family homes being the most prevalent, reflecting a mix of architectural styles from classic ranch to contemporary designs. The housing market is primarily composed of single-family residences, with a smaller but significant portion of apartments and townhouses accommodating various living preferences. The area has seen a steady growth in housing developments, particularly from the late 20th century onwards. The homeownership rate in Warner Robins is robust, with a majority of residents owning their homes, while a proportionate number opt for renting.

While more than 10 listings in Warner Robins, GA in April 2025 were sold above asking price, there were more than 29 listings sold at asking price, and more than 34 were sold below. Between March and April 2025, Warner Robins, GA real estate market has seen increase in the number of listings by 21.2%. The median list price of listings available in April 2025 was $236,403, while the average time on the real estate market was 35 days.
